Fall is a great time of year to tie on small body crankbaits to target big limits of bass that have moved shallow to feed heavy in anticipation for the cold winter ahead. The fall season is dominated by shad but keep in mind that with the full moon that falls during the early weeks of fall that the crawfish become very active, this can often ignite a crawdad bite that can make for incredible fishing.
